[13], NO2 is used as an intermediate in the manufacturing of nitric acid, as a nitrating agent in the manufacturing of chemical explosives, as a polymerization inhibitor for acrylates, as a flour bleaching agent,[14]:223 and as a room temperature sterilization agent. The main oxides of nitrogen are: - nitrogen monoxide (NO) which is a colorless and odorless gas; - nitrogen dioxide (NO2) which is a brown-redish gas with a strong, drowning smell.
